The spark plugs in a Honda VTX 1300 can be removed by first removing the spark plug wire. Twist the spark plug out, using a spark plug socket. Reverse the process to install the new spark plug.

According to the Honda VTX1300 Service Manual, the plugs should be gapped at 0.9mm.

You should follow the recommended schedule listed in the manual. The manual for my 2002 VTX 1800C recommends changing them every 24,000 miles.

The Honda VTX 1300 was manufactured in Japan. Specifically, it was produced at Honda's facilities in Kumamoto, where many of the company's motorcycles are assembled. The VTX 1300 was popular for its cruiser style and was part of Honda’s VTX series, which was known for its performance and design.
